Full Cast & Crew of Crust

  • Kevin McNally – Bill Simmonds
  • Perry Fitzpatrick – Steve Crump
  • Madhav Sharma – Hamid Choudhury
  • Mark Bazeley – Clive
  • Lee Oakes – Crouty
